概括
经历营养不良的老年人有较高的低温和寒冷天气中事故的风险. 保持充足的营养和温暖对于预防老年人的严重健康后果至关重要.

背景情况:
- 20世纪80年代对温度调节的研究突出了影响人体温度调节的因素.
- 关于退休人员冬季燃料支付的政治辩论促使对这项研究进行了审查.
- 老年人温度调节障碍会导致严重的健康问题,尤其是在寒冷的天气中.
研究的目的:
- 审查温度调节的生理机制.
- 检查营养状况和温度调节之间的关系.
- 了解老年人温度调节受损的后果,并将其与其他人口进行比较.
主要方法:
- 审查关于温度调节及其与营养关系的历史研究.
- 对老年人骨折大腿骨入院率与环境温度相关的分析.
- 在营养不良与营养良好的个体中对寒冷刺激的生理反应的比较.
主要成果:
- 在老年人中,随着温度的下降,骨骨折的入院率显著增加,特别是在严重营养不良 (300%的增长) 与营养良好 (30%的增长) 相比.
- 严重营养不良的个体经历了≥1°C的核心温度降低,而营养良好的个体保持了正常热量.
- 营养不良的个体对寒冷刺激失去正常的代谢反应 (代谢率增加10%),与营养良好组不同.
结论:
- 在老年人中,营养不良,轻度低温和意外之间存在因果关系.
- 由于营养不良导致的温度调节的生理挑战在老年人和极地探险者中是相似的.
- 确保老年人在冬季获得足够的温暖和营养,在医疗和人道主义方面是必不可少的.

Masonry in Cold and Hot Weather Conditions
324
In cold weather, masonry construction requires specific precautions to ensure mortar does not freeze before curing, as this can significantly weaken its strength and watertightness. Mortar temperature should be maintained between 60°F and 80°F to support proper hydration and curing. Below 40°F, mortar water must be heated, but should not exceed 120°F as high temperatures can reduce mortar's compressive and bond strength.

Decreased Body Temperature
981
A decreased body temperature can occur in patients with hypothermia and frostbite. Heat loss with extended cold exposure overpowers the body's ability to create heat, resulting in hypothermia. Core temperature readings help classify hypothermia. Mild hypothermia is temperatures between 32 °C (89.6 °F) and 35°C (95 °F) and is caused by impaired thermoregulation. Cold Weather Concreting
343
When freshly poured concrete is exposed to freezing temperatures before it has set, the water within the concrete can freeze. This expansion disrupts the setting process, delays chemical reactions necessary for hardening, and increases the volume of pores within the hardened concrete, which weakens its overall structure. If the concrete manages to reach an appreciable strength before it freezes, the damage can be somewhat mitigated.

Thermosensation
33.6K
Peripheral thermosensation is the perception of external temperature. A change in temperature (on the surface of the skin and other tissues) is detected by a family of temperature-sensitive ion channels called Transient Receptor Potential, or TRP, receptors. These receptors are located on free nerve endings. Those detecting cold temperatures are closer to the surface of the skin than the nerve endings detecting warmth.
